问题标签 [cadence-workflow]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
215 浏览

cadence-workflow - 如何从 Cadence 工作流程或活动发出自定义指标?

Cadence 使用计数发出一堆指标。是否可以使用 Cadence SDK 发出我自己的指标?

Go SDK 有cadence.GetMetricsScope().Counter(counterName).Inc(),但是当我调用它时它似乎不起作用。我是否缺少一些必需的配置?

0 投票
1 回答
355 浏览

cadence-workflow - Uber Cadence Workflow 版本变更兼容性

我了解我不能对工作流程进行向后不兼容的更改: 如何在不破坏确定性的情况下对 Uber Cadence 工作流程进行更改或修复?

但是我不确定这里的“向后不兼容”是什么意思。我可以在不使用 getVersion 的情况下不部署新代码吗?或者只要用于恢复的历史跟踪在两个版本之间兼容,那么我可以在没有 getVersion 的情况下进行更新?或者我可以在某些条件下不使用 getVersion 进行更新?

0 投票
1 回答
291 浏览

distributed-system - 有人试过在 cockroach db 上运行 cadence

开箱即用的 cadenace docker 镜像带有 cassandra 依赖项,并且有基于 mysql 和 postgres 的镜像可用。有没有人尝试过使用 cockroach db 运行 cadence,本质上 cockroachdb 使用 postgres 引擎进行 sql。

我试图将 postgres 图像更改为 cockroach,但它没有用

0 投票
1 回答
87 浏览

cadence-workflow - Cadence UI 上的 Cadence 工作流程输出以纯文本形式显示用户/密码

我使用了 Cadence 工作流程。我将一个结构作为参数传递给工作流。它具有与服务和用户密码的一些连接详细信息它作为输入传递给该工作流中的活动

当工作流的活动完成时,Cadence UI 会以纯文本形式显示活动详细信息以及用户/密码

有没有办法停止在 UI 中显示 Cadence 工作流活动输入/输出的此类用户/密码值?请帮忙

0 投票
1 回答
130 浏览

message-queue - 为什么放入队列可以解决数据不一致?

我正在研究一种叫做 Cadence 的工具,它可以用来降低开发分布式系统的复杂性。

我看到了这个视频,https://youtu.be/llmsBGKOuWI?t=108

从 1:40 开始,他提到在发送交易时,包括借记和贷记,如果其中一个操作失败,就会出现一致性问题,我们可以通过放入队列来解决。

演讲者没有提到它的原因,我在想是因为队列可以启用重播消息吗?还是我错过了其他一些原因?

任何答案或意见表示赞赏!

0 投票
0 回答
67 浏览

java - 接口 com.cadence.javademo.workflows.HelloWorldWorkflow 在类加载器中不可见

我是 CadenceWorkflow 的新手,我正在使用 Spring Boot 实现 Hello World Web 应用程序。也通过了链接,但不知道如何解决。

参考下面的代码

0 投票
1 回答
317 浏览

go - Cadence 长时间运行的子工作流程

对于长时间运行的活动,我们可以使用心跳来通知活动是在运行还是停止。

我们有一个工作流,它根据父工作流生成的分组调用带有一些参数的多个子工作流。子工作流程是长期运行的工作流程。
有没有办法让子工作流发送类似的心跳,因为这些工作流长时间运行,超时设置为几个小时?或者更确切地说,通知子工作流正在运行的方式是什么?

我们正在使用 go-client 来实现工作流。

0 投票
1 回答
289 浏览

cadence-workflow - Cadence 或 Temporal 中的自定义工作流程

我计划在架构中使用 Cadence 或 Temporal Workflow,但是我们计划在决定工作流时赋予用户很大的权力。Cadence 和 Temporal 在他们的用例中都提到他们的 SDK 支持自定义 DSL,但我看不到该功能。你能帮帮我吗?

0 投票
1 回答
150 浏览

cadence-workflow - 维护 Cadence 工作流程信号的顺序

假设我有一个接收信号1T-0和信号2的工作流程T+1。然后在 T+2 执行工作流。当工作流运行时,我是否保证它会在信号 2 之前收到信号 1?换一种说法,Cadence 是否维护工作流中传入信号的顺序?

0 投票
1 回答
792 浏览

cadence-workflow - 使用异步活动与让工作流等待信号

假设我们需要向用户发送电子邮件并等待用户回复,然后继续工作流程。我们是否应该创建一个异步活动来发送电子邮件,并在收到回复电子邮件时完成活动?或者我们应该创建一个正常的活动来发送电子邮件,然后工作流等待一个信号,当回复电子邮件到来时,我们将信号发送到工作流?这两个选项是否等效?或者有一些差异可以用来决定哪一个用于不同的活动?

提前致谢